Indiaâs Central Asian Struggle
By Sreeram Chaulia
Central Asia is the most coveted area in the world for strategic influence. By virtue of its location at geopolitical crossroads and its vast mineral treasures, the region of the six âstansâ (Afghanistan, Tajikistan, Uzbekistan,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an and Turkmenistan) has been a prized object of contention for great powers of different eras. In the 13th century, Mongoliaâs Changez Khanâs swept across the area, killing 15 million people and plundering its resources. Changezâs imperialism in the Caucasus and Russia was facilitated by his control of the Central Asian steppes.
